Output 4625be4b208aa9bbc52c1b84f7a1196350f25079667711f9f657a05f32af1fe1:0

value
26305519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f36a372f0429cfac6186b5ceed1f3f88f99f19b OP_EQUAL
address
3LafFbmbPDXSYr3XPiHNPnLGkiTvUAU1cm
transaction
4625be4b208aa9bbc52c1b84f7a1196350f25079667711f9f657a05f32af1fe1
confirmations
423804
spent
true